Maud Berridge (1845-1907) was the wife of a Master Mariner, and she travelled with him on at least five occasions (1869, 1880, 1882, 1883, 1886), sailing to Melbourne with emigrants and cargo.
Her enthusiasm for new experiences shines through her writing..
The book will tell Maud\'s story through her own words and through a number of relevant contemporary documents and will paint a picture of the life of a captain\'s wife in the Victorian era as well as aspects of society in Britain, the US and Australia at the time.
Maud wrote diaries of these Voyages of which one in particular, that of the 1883 voyage, comprise some 50 000 words.
There are also some photographs of Henry, Maud and the crew taken in San Francisco, and a photo from the State Library of Victoria showing the Superb at dock in Melbourne.
The whole voyage took 14 months.
They then sailed down the west coast of the Americas, around Cape Horn and on to Queenstown in County Cork (134 days).
Here they stayed for two months exploring SF and surrounds, unloaded the coal and took on a load of wheat (in large bags) at Port Costa.
In 1883, they sailed on from Melbourne to Newcastle in New South Wales to take on a load of coal, then on through the Windward Isles to San Francisco (51 days).
In 1880, Maud and Henry took their two sons (aged six and eight) with them.
Record times taken from London to Melbourne under Captain Henry were 79 days (1878), 76 days (1881) and a final time of 74 days (1886).
However, most of Henry and Maud\'s Voyages were undertaken in the three-masted clipper Superb, sailing from Gravesend at the start of summer and leaving Melbourne for home at the end of the year (the southern summer, best for heading east with the trade winds and rounding Cape Horn).
The first occasion was 1869 just after they were married, when Henry was Captain of the Walmer Castle, and they returned via New Zealand instead of travelling east and around Cape Horn.
